ABSTRACT

Depression is one of the most psychiatric disorders that there are many treatments for it. Milk thistle is a plant which has many pharmacologic effects such as antioxidant, anti-inflammatory and anticancer. It is reported that silymarin [main component of milk thistle] increase the concentration of some neurotransmitter in brain. Evaluation of the antidepressant effect of aqueous and ethanolic extracts of milk thistle. We investigated the antidepressant effect of aqueous [0.72, 1.26, 1.80 g/kg] and ethanolic [0.24,0.42,0.6 g/kg] extracts using modified forced swimming test in mice. The ethanolic extract did not have any effect on the duration of immobility of mice. However, the aqueous extract significantly reduced the duration of immobility versus the control group. Aqueous extract of milk thistle showed antidepressant effect in animal model
